About Petri Suomala
Petri Suomala is a scholar working on Management Information Systems, Strategy and Management and Management Science and Operations Research, having authored 53 papers that have together received 705 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Accounting and Organizational Management (16 papers), Innovation and Knowledge Management (9 papers), Quality and Supply Management (8 papers), Technology Assessment and Management (7 papers), Customer Service Quality and Loyalty (6 papers), Service and Product Innovation (6 papers), Construction Project Management and Performance (6 papers) and Product Development and Customization (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Management Information Systems (306 citations), Marketing (128 citations) and Strategy and Management (203 citations). Petri Suomala has collaborated with scholars based in Finland, Sweden and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Teemu Laine, Tuomas Korhonen, Jari Paranko, Kari Lukka, Marko Seppänen, Jan Holmström, Mats I. Johansson, Falconer Mitchell, Miia Martinsuo and Juho Kanniainen. Their work appears in journals such as International Journal of Production Economics, Industrial Marketing Management and International Journal of Project Management.
